Improving Sales with Promotional Strategies
Every business owner knows that in order to earn a profit, he or she has to convince consumers to purchase or take advantage of products and services. The problem, however, is that there are some companies who don’t know how to implement appropriate marketing strategies that will help reach out to clients, and as such aren’t progressing as well as they had hoped. This either means they aren’t well-known or people just have a bad impression of them. If you are experiencing this same dilemma with your establishment, keep in mind that your target customers are the lifeblood of your enterprise. It’s not enough that you provide quality merchandise. You should also go out of your way to actually get to know the individuals you cater and vice versa.
One way of accomplishing this is to let them have something to look forward to. A prime example would be to organise a promotional event, particularly one wherein they can receive great incentives or freebies. The next concern would be the necessary things you need to prepare. To give you an idea on the next, you must first evaluate your company’s performance, particularly the sales aspect. Dwell on the factors that are not doing so well. For instance, you might have a product that is not generating that much profit.
The second step would be to think of different ways to improve these elements. Going back to the example, you can either hype the merchandise by coming up with an enticing marketing scheme. Let’s say, when a customer purchased a certain amount, he or she can get one or two packs free.
In order for this to work, you must inform people regarding this promo, preferably a few weeks before it is implemented. You can hang posters in your store’s premises, place an advert in the newspaper or, if you really want to let many people know as soon as possible, you can release a radio or television commercial. Be creative with your collaterals by including slogans that create a sense of urgency. Don’t forget the important details, such as the mechanics, the duration of the event, as well as the marketing scheme. Never advertise any false information for this will negatively affect your company’s credibility. Lastly, once the event is through, make sure to have an accurate progress report so that you can analyse whether it is effective or not.
Basically, you should be creative in convincing your customers to avail of your goods and services.
